Ελέγξτε εάν οι ρυθμίσεις μεγέθους χαρτιού του φύλλου εργασίας είναι Αυτόματες
Εισαγωγή
Κατά το χειρισμό υπολογιστικών φύλλων, η διασφάλιση της βέλτιστης παρουσίασης για εκτύπωση είναι ζωτικής σημασίας. Μια βασική πτυχή αυτού είναι η ρύθμιση μεγέθους χαρτιού. Σε αυτόν τον οδηγό, θα διερευνήσουμε πώς να προσδιορίσουμε εάν το μέγεθος χαρτιού ενός φύλλου εργασίας έχει οριστεί σε αυτόματο χρησιμοποιώντας το Aspose.Cells για .NET. Αυτή η ισχυρή βιβλιοθήκη επιτρέπει την απρόσκοπτη διαχείριση του Excel, καθιστώντας τις εργασίες σας πιο αποτελεσματικές και διαχειρίσιμες.
Προαπαιτούμενα
Πριν ξεκινήσουμε την κωδικοποίηση, ας βεβαιωθούμε ότι έχετε την απαραίτητη ρύθμιση:
-
Περιβάλλον ανάπτυξης C#: Χρειάζεστε ένα κατάλληλο IDE όπως το Visual Studio. Εάν δεν το έχετε εγκαταστήσει ακόμα, μπορείτε να το κατεβάσετε από τον ιστότοπο της Microsoft.
-
Aspose.Cells Library: Βεβαιωθείτε ότι έχετε τη βιβλιοθήκη Aspose.Cells. Μπορείτε εύκολα να το κατεβάσετε απόAspose.
-
Βασικές γνώσεις C#: Η εξοικείωση με τις αρχές προγραμματισμού C# θα σας βοηθήσει να κατανοήσετε αποτελεσματικά τα παρεχόμενα παραδείγματα.
-
Δείγμα αρχείων Excel: Λάβετε τα ακόλουθα δείγματα αρχείων για να εργαστείτε:
samplePageSetupIsAutomaticPaperSize-False.xlsx
samplePageSetupIsAutomaticPaperSize-True.xlsx
Με αυτές τις προϋποθέσεις, είστε έτοιμοι να ξεκινήσετε!
Ρύθμιση του έργου σας
Δημιουργία Νέου Έργου
- Ανοίξτε το Visual Studio.
- Δημιουργήστε ένα νέο έργο εφαρμογής C# Console. Μπορείτε να το ονομάσετε
CheckPaperSize
.
Προσθήκη αναφοράς Aspose.Cells
- Κάντε δεξί κλικ στο έργο σας στην Εξερεύνηση λύσεων.
- Επιλέξτε Διαχείριση πακέτων NuGet.
- Αναζητήστε το Aspose.Cells και εγκαταστήστε το.
Τώρα, προσθέστε τον ακόλουθο χώρο ονομάτων στον κώδικά σας:
using System;
using System.IO;
using Aspose.Cells;
Βήμα 1: Ορισμός καταλόγου προέλευσης και εξόδου
Ξεκινήστε καθορίζοντας τη θέση των δειγμάτων αρχείων Excel και πού θέλετε να αποθηκεύσετε τυχόν εξόδους:
// Ορίστε τον κατάλογο προέλευσης για τα αρχεία Excel
string sourceDir = "Your Document Directory";
Βήμα 2: Φορτώστε τα βιβλία εργασίας
Στη συνέχεια, φορτώστε τα δύο βιβλία εργασίας που ετοιμάστηκαν νωρίτερα:
// Τοποθετήστε το πρώτο βιβλίο εργασίας με αυτόματο μέγεθος χαρτιού ρυθμισμένο σε false
Workbook wb1 = new Workbook(sourceDir + "samplePageSetupIsAutomaticPaperSize-False.xlsx");
// Τοποθετήστε το δεύτερο βιβλίο εργασίας με αυτόματο μέγεθος χαρτιού που έχει οριστεί σε true
Workbook wb2 = new Workbook(sourceDir + "samplePageSetupIsAutomaticPaperSize-True.xlsx");
Αυτό επιτρέπει την αποτελεσματική σύγκριση των ρυθμίσεων.
Βήμα 3: Πρόσβαση στα φύλλα εργασίας
Τώρα, αποκτήστε πρόσβαση στο πρώτο φύλλο εργασίας και από τα δύο βιβλία εργασίας:
// Πρόσβαση στο πρώτο φύλλο εργασίας και από τα δύο βιβλία εργασίας
Worksheet ws1 = wb1.Worksheets[0];
Worksheet ws2 = wb2.Worksheets[0];
Βήμα 4: Ελέγξτε την ιδιότητα IsAutomaticPaperSize
Για να επαληθεύσετε τις ρυθμίσεις μεγέθους χαρτιού, ελέγξτε τοIsAutomaticPaperSize
ιδιοκτησία:
// Εξαγωγή της ιδιότητας PageSetup.IsAutomaticPaperSize και των δύο φύλλων εργασίας
Console.WriteLine("First Workbook - IsAutomaticPaperSize: " + ws1.PageSetup.IsAutomaticPaperSize);
Console.WriteLine("Second Workbook - IsAutomaticPaperSize: " + ws2.PageSetup.IsAutomaticPaperSize);
Αυτό εκτυπώνει εάν η δυνατότητα αυτόματου μεγέθους χαρτιού είναι ενεργοποιημένη για κάθε φύλλο εργασίας.
Βήμα 5: Επιβεβαίωση των αποτελεσμάτων
Τέλος, εκτυπώστε ένα μήνυμα επιτυχίας για να επιβεβαιώσετε ότι το πρόγραμμα εκτελέστηκε με επιτυχία:
Console.WriteLine();
Console.WriteLine("Paper size check executed successfully.");
Σύναψη
Σε αυτό το σεμινάριο, εξερευνήσαμε με επιτυχία πώς να ελέγξουμε εάν οι ρυθμίσεις μεγέθους χαρτιού των φύλλων εργασίας σε αρχεία Excel έχουν οριστεί σε αυτόματες χρησιμοποιώντας το Aspose.Cells για .NET. Ακολουθώντας αυτά τα βήματα, έχετε πλέον τις θεμελιώδεις δεξιότητες για να χειριστείτε μέσω προγραμματισμού αρχεία Excel και να επαληθεύσετε συγκεκριμένες διαμορφώσεις, όπως το μέγεθος χαρτιού.
Συχνές ερωτήσεις
Τι είναι το Aspose.Cells;
Το Aspose.Cells είναι μια ευέλικτη βιβλιοθήκη σχεδιασμένη για χειρισμό εγγράφων Excel σε εφαρμογές .NET, επιτρέποντας προηγμένη διαχείριση αρχείων και λειτουργικότητα.
Υπάρχει δωρεάν έκδοση του Aspose.Cells;
Ναι, το Aspose προσφέρει μια δωρεάν δοκιμαστική έκδοση, την οποία μπορείτε να κατεβάσετεεδώ.
Πώς μπορώ να αγοράσω άδεια χρήσης για το Aspose.Cells;
Μπορείτε να αποκτήσετε άδεια μέσω της σελίδας αγοράς τους, που είναι διαθέσιμηεδώ.
Τι τύπους αρχείων Excel μπορώ να χειριστώ χρησιμοποιώντας το Aspose.Cells;
Το Aspose.Cells υποστηρίζει μια ποικιλία μορφών, συμπεριλαμβανομένων των XLS, XLSX και CSV, μεταξύ άλλων.
Πού μπορώ να βρω υποστήριξη για το Aspose.Cells;
Για υποστήριξη και πόρους, επισκεφθείτε το φόρουμ Asposeεδώ.